Executive Summary
The Confederation of African Football (CAF) has instructed Kenya to pay a $30 million hosting commitment fee. This payment serves as confirmation of Kenya's preparedness to co-host the 2027 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ON). The directive from CAF places significant financial pressure on Kenya. It remains to be seen how the Kenyan government will respond to this demand and whether they can meet the financial obligation within the stipulated timeframe. The successful co-hosting of AFCON could bring substantial economic and reputational benefits to Kenya.
